Termanology
Rapper
Rapper and producer who first earned buzz in 2006, when his song "Watch How It Go Down" became an underground sensation. He has since released acclaimed albums like Politics as Usual (2008), G.O.Y.A. (2013), and More Politics (2016).
He grew up in the predominantly Latino city of Lawrence, Massachusetts. He began writing original verses at age 15.
He wrote the song "Here in Liberty City" specifically for the soundtrack to the video game Grand Theft Auto: The Lost and the Damned.
His real name is Daniel Carrillo. He is of French and Puerto Rican descent.
He collaborated with producer Statik Selektah on the albums 1982 (2010) and 2012 (2012).
